With that energy fresh in our minds, today we want to talk about an important leadership transition that will shape the future of Jagex.
After 14 years at Jagex, with the last eight as CEO, Phil Mansell (Mod Pips) will be stepping back from his role. Phil has been an instrumental force in shaping both RuneScape and Old School RuneScape, leading the company through some of its most defining moments: the launch of Old School RuneScape, the expansion onto mobile, record-breaking player numbers, and ensuring the RuneScape games remain the most community-driven MMORPGs in the world.
Phil will remain with Jagex to support this transition before taking a well-deserved break, and we want to take a moment to thank him for his leadership, dedication, and passion over the years.
Introducing Mod North
Taking the reins as our new CEO is Jon Bellamy (Mod North), a leader with deep experience in both Jagex and the RuneScape communities.
Mod North previously worked at Jagex from 2015 to 2018 and has served as an advisor for us more recently. More importantly, he has been a dedicated RuneScape player for over 20 years, once maxing an RS3 account and nearly maxing his OSRS account. He understands the game, the players, and the unique culture that makes RuneScape special.
North’s leadership will focus on building upon the strong foundation we have today while ensuring the long-term success of RuneScape and Old School RuneScape. His approach is rooted in community-first decision-making, and he is fully committed to the values that have made these games thrive for decades.
What This Means for the RuneScape Games
Our commitment to the integrity of both RuneScape and Old School RuneScape remains steadfast. While leadership may change, the core values that define them will not.
We want to be clear: this transition does not signal a change in monetisation strategy, game direction, or how we engage with the community. The roadmap, our approach to updates, and our commitment to listening to players remain unchanged. We will continue to build upon the strong foundations of both games, delivering meaningful content updates, maintaining economic fairness, and ensuring that our players remain central to everything we do.
Old School RuneScape will always be a community-driven experience, where fairness and player input are paramount. The polling system, transparent development process, and our commitments to non-intrusive monetisation are here to stay. Progression will continue to be earned entirely through gameplay rather than external advantages and all achievements, milestones, and accomplishments are a direct result of player effort.
RuneScape is a cherished game with over two decades of history, and its future will continue to be built on the same principles that have guided its success: community obsession, authenticity, and reverence for its DNA. We will continue maintaining fairness in the in-game economy, ensuring that updates respect the balance of the game world, with transparency in our decisions, and a willingness to explore meaningful changes to MTX offerings in RuneScape.
This leadership transition does not alter our dedication to these values. We are fully committed to ensuring both games continue to thrive for years to come, providing players with the rich, immersive, and fair experiences they know and love.
